Madaripur Population - Basti, Uttar Pradesh

Madaripur is a small village located in Basti Tehsil of Basti district, Uttar Pradesh with total 17 families residing. The Madaripur village has population of 102 of which 61 are males while 41 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Madaripur village population of children with age 0-6 is 17 which makes up 16.67 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Madaripur village is 672 which is lower than Uttar Pradesh state average of 912. Child Sex Ratio for the Madaripur as per census is 1125, higher than Uttar Pradesh average of 902.

Madaripur village has higher literacy rate compared to Uttar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Madaripur village was 72.94 % compared to 67.68 % of Uttar Pradesh. In Madaripur Male literacy stands at 84.91 % while female literacy rate was 53.13 %.

Caste Factor

In Madaripur village, most of the villagers are from Schedule Caste (SC).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 86.27 % of total population in Madaripur village. The village Madaripur currently doesn’t have any Schedule Tribe (ST) population.

Work Profile

In Madaripur village out of total population, 38 were engaged in work activities. 26.32 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 73.68 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 38 workers engaged in Main Work, 10 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 0 were Agricultural labourer.
